![html type text 输入单号后回车自动提交了表单,这个时候需要自动清空文本框的内容,继续输入,第1张 html type text 输入单号后回车自动提交了表单,这个时候需要自动清空文本框的内容,继续输入,第1张](/aiimages/html+type+text+%E8%BE%93%E5%85%A5%E5%8D%95%E5%8F%B7%E5%90%8E%E5%9B%9E%E8%BD%A6%E8%87%AA%E5%8A%A8%E6%8F%90%E4%BA%A4%E4%BA%86%E8%A1%A8%E5%8D%95%EF%BC%8C%E8%BF%99%E4%B8%AA%E6%97%B6%E5%80%99%E9%9C%80%E8%A6%81%E8%87%AA%E5%8A%A8%E6%B8%85%E7%A9%BA%E6%96%87%E6%9C%AC%E6%A1%86%E7%9A%84%E5%86%85%E5%AE%B9%EF%BC%8C%E7%BB%A7%E7%BB%AD%E8%BE%93%E5%85%A5.png)
每个浏览器都是不同的,取决于你调试的浏览器。1.如果
表单中有 type = “ submit”
按钮,则回车键生效。图2。如果表单中只有一个 type = “ text”输入,则不管按钮的
类型如何,输入键都会生效。图3。如果按钮不是输入,但按钮,没有类型添加,即缺省类型 = 按钮和 fx 缺省类型 = 提交。图4。其他形式元素,如 textarea 和 select,不受影响。单选复选框不会影响触发规则,但是它会在 fx 下响应返回键而不是 Internet Explorer。5.Type = “ image”输入时,效果相当于 type = “ submit” ,不知道为什么设计这样的类型,不推荐,应该加上 css 背景图更合适。通过submit()方法提交一个表单时,它是不会触发form元素的onsubmit()事件的,你得调用form并触发它的onsubmit():如document.forms.myFormName.onsubmit()<form id="subForm">
<input type="text" name="username" onchange="opear(this)"/>
</form>
<script src="jquery.js" />
<script>
function opear(obj){
var username = $(obj).val()
if(username.length>9){
$("#subForm").submit()
}
}
</script>
评论列表(0条)